room temperature
phrase: If something is at room temperature, its temperature is neither hot nor cold.

room temperature in British English
a comfortable indoor temperature, generally considered to be between 20 and 25°C (68 to 77° F)
noun: the normal temperature of a living room, usually taken as being around 20° C
